KUALA TERENGGANU (Bernama): Police seized more than RM1.72mil worth of drugs and arrested three men and a woman suspected to be drug traffickers in two raids in Kemasik, Kemaman on Monday (June 8).
Terengganu police chief Deputy Comm Datuk Roslee Chik said in the first raid on a house in the area around 5.30am, police arrested three men, aged in their 20s and 40s, and seized 40 bottles containing heroin, 1.3kg of syabu and 42,200 horse pills or yaba, worth about RM1.058mil.
